A Huntingburg man was placed under arrest and another was cited after they were found to be in possession of narcotics and paraphernalia over the weekend at the Jasper WalMart store.

Just before 4:30 Saturday afternoon Jasper Police were called to the northside super center after receiving a complaint of a man under the influence, trespassing and refusing to leave the store when asked.

Police say the man 24-year old Josh Blume was found in a vehicle passed out along with a second male identified as 19-year old Logan Schmitt of Huntingburg.

Police say Schmitt had drug paraphernalia and also synthetic marijuana in plain view in the car.

Schmitt was taken to and booked into the Dubois County Security Center on misdemeanor counts of possession of marijuana and drug paraphernalia

Blume was cited by police for possession of paraphernalia.
